This vivid and exciting historical adventure has a superb narration by Maggie Mash. Mash illuminates the story of a 13-year-old boy who is preparing to accompany Richard the Lionheart to the Crusades, bringing to life the developing love between the boy and the magnificent blood red stallion, Hosanna. Mash gives a sensitive and upbeat interpretation of all the characters, including a Muslim boy still filled with sadness and anger over his parents' death at the hands of Christians. She soon has you caring deeply for everyone in this multilayered tale. This is a book that truly has something for everyone. D.G.
